Fulvio Caldini (born 1959) is an Italian composer,[1] pianist, and musicologist. Since the 1980s he has created a large body of works, which are generally composed according to minimal principles, showing particular influence from the music of Steve Reich. Caldini has a preference for wind instruments (particularly double reeds in his compositions, frequently writing for his brother Sandro Caldini, who plays the oboe, oboe d'amore, and english horn.
